HP Color LaserJet CP1525nw Review
Hewlett & Packard brings the HP Color LaserJet CP1525nw printer that is capable of providing professional color documents wirelessly. With added network-ability, the printer is comprehensible to set up and print from anywhere. This eco-friendly printer utilizes a set of technologies that generate minimal impact on the environment and in your wallet. The printer gives out complete results and sensible functionality that is suitable for marketing materials. The boxy-like design, with its rounded off edges, will fit upon any desktop hutch; its dimensions are 15.7-inches wide, 17.8-inches deep, 10-inches tall, with a weight of 40 pounds.
This smallish printer will print at a percentage of 12 Letter A sized pages per minute in Black and 8 Letter A sized pages per minute in Color. HP recommends a monthly amount of 250-1000 pages per month, but the printer is capable of extending the volume to around 30,000 pages. So, it is expedient to have a printer capable of a decent quantity of prints, and if needed, beyond the recommendation. The printer incorporates HP ImageREt 3600 technologies and prints at a resolution of 600 x 600 dots per inch for both modes, Black and Color. The printer's network-ability allows some leeway for useful functionality with its wireless connections and implicit Ethernet port. Users can print from any location with the HP ePrint software. The device is relatively painless to set up from the start. Managers may determine the cost per print with included software, and there are various tools and templates that users may apply at their discretion. Shortcuts can be pre-configured to optimize quality production and speeds based on the selected media. Wireless management is extensive with its password-protected incorporated web server. Managers may disable/enable network parts at their discretion. The printer has standard memory of 128 Mega Bytes, expandable up to 384 Mega Bytes, running with a processor speed of 600 MHz. With only active acoustic levels up to 48 decibels, the printer should operate reasonably quiet behind the scenes. The standard languages the printer utilizes are PCL 6, PCL 5, and PostScript 3. Maximum allowable document sizes are 8.5 x 14-inches and a minimum size of 3 x 5-inches. The output tray, its location on the middle-top of the printer, can hold up to 125 sheets. The input tray can hold up to 150 sheets with its location at the bottom-front of the printer. Upgrading is limited to the printers DIMM system, which modifies the memory to 128 Mega Bytes 256 Mega Bytes using 144-pin DIMMs. This printer could be an obvious choice if an organization needs to juggle multiple jobs with speed and accuracy. The HP Color LaserJet CP1525nw has a decent processor speed capable of dishing out up to 20 pages per minute, depending on the complexity of prints. This printer is quite cost-effective and durable. The printer utilizes a 2-line LCD with a 16-character display, which is appropriate, but could be better with visuals and a higher resolution.
The resolution is limited to 600 x 600 dots per inch; most InkJet printers have greater resolution with excellent prints. If a business specializes in graphic design, photography, and imaging than this is not the printer for them. Unfortunately, this printer is not a 'one size fits all'. The printer lacks faxing and copying features. The printer runs on 295 watts when operating. This is a sizable impact on the electric bill. With the given specs, it 295 watts consumption does not make much sense when other printers with obvious higher-end specs consume less. |
